Argentina inflation projections drop to between 1.6% and 1.9% for August
Private consultancies in Argentina have significantly lowered their inflation projections for August, estimating the Consumer Price Index (CPI) will fall between 1.6% and 1.9%. This represents a notable deceleration compared to July, when inflation reached 2.1% due to winter holiday spending and increases in recreation, culture, and hospitality sectors.
Analysts attribute this downward trend primarily to cooling prices in the food and beverages category. For instance, Eco Go projects a 1.6% general index based on a 0.3% increase in food prices during the second week of August. Analytica reported a 1.7% average over the last four weeks, noting that while vegetables rose by 4.8%, fruits and meats saw much smaller increases.
EconViews provided the highest estimate at 1.9%, though they noted the possibility of the final figure being slightly lower. If these projections hold, August would mark a return to the lower price increase levels seen in June 2025.
